The Legacy of Luna: The Story of a Tree, a Woman and the Struggle to Save the Redwoods Apparel The Tolowa & Yurok peopleHill had climbed 180 feet up into the tree high on a mountain on December 10, 1997, for what she thought would be a two to three week long "tree sit." The action was intended to stop Pacific Lumber, a division of the Maxxam Corporation, from the environmentally destructive process of clear cutting the ancient redwood and the trees around it.
